Identification of Stimulatory and Inhibitory Inputs to the Hypothalamic‐Pituitary‐Adrenal Axis During Hypoglycaemia or Transport In Ewes

Abstract: This study used the novel approach of statistical modelling to investigate the control of hypothalamic‐pituitary‐adrenal (HPA) axis and quantify temporal relationships between hormones. Two experimental paradigms were chosen, insulin‐induced hypoglycaemia and 2 h transport, to assess differences in control between noncognitive and cognitive stimuli. Vasopressin and corticotropin‐releasing hormone (CRH) were measured in hypophysial portal plasma, and adrenocorticotropin hormone (ACTH) and cortisol in jugular pl… Show more
